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Heathrow Bus (All Stations) to Atherton start from as little as £47.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Heathrow Bus (All Stations) to Atherton start from £89.30 one way, or £128.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Heathrow Bus (All Stations) to Atherton are available for £148.60 one way, or £283.00 return

Everything you need to know about Atherton Station

Atherton Train Station: Your Gateway to Greater Manchester

Nestled amidst the vibrant network of Northern England's railway links, Atherton Train Station serves as a convenient connector for both locals and visitors navigating the Greater Manchester region. Whether you’re commuting to work or exploring the rich cultural heritage of nearby cities, Atherton station can be your launching pad for unforgettable journeys.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Atherton station offers several amenities to enhance your travel experience. The station is equipped with a ticket office operational from early morning till late at night, ensuring you can grab your tickets conveniently before starting your journey. Ticket machines facilitate the collection of online tickets, although they currently lack accessibility features. This station also supports smartcards, although no validators are available on-site.

For assistance and support, station staff are on hand to aid passengers during specified hours, with further help available through the helpline at any time. While there are no waiting rooms or lounging facilities, the station is equipped with step-free access to all platforms, making it accessible for those with mobility concerns. Unfortunately, facilities such as toilets, refreshment outlets, and parking surveillance are not available, though the car park offers 64 spaces free of charge.

Travel Connections at Atherton

Atherton station provides a variety of transport links to make your onward journey seamless. Whether it's a short bus ride or a taxi trip to your next destination, the station's connectivity aids hassle-free travel. Bus pickups and taxi services are readily available, and for the well-prepared traveler, there’s a handy link to help plan your journey online. Although bicycle hire isn't an option at the station, bicycle storage is available with some uncovered spaces.
